Wildstang used a Palm 505 for its dashboard program. We were at GLR, but I'm not sure if it's the one you saw. I didn't work on that project so I don't know if they'll release the code or not. The dashboard displayed the values from our crab pots, the joystick inputs, and the current draw from 8 (I believe) motors. Another team that used a Palm in its controls was Team 148(?). The are a team from Texas with the covered wagon as their cart. Along with a custom circuit board the Palm recorded the power used by their motors during competition. The used the data to analyze the robot's performance after the match. I don't think it worked in real time, but I could be wrong.
